 Home :: About Us :: Our Work
others
  • To encourage the establishment of Parent-Teacher Associations;
  • To promote positive attitudes towards home-school co-operation and parent education through publicity programmes, publicity for good ideas, workshops and seminars;
  • To disburse grants to schools which have ideas for innovative approaches to improving home-school co-operation and enhancing parent education, and to ensure that successful schemes are publicized;
  • To develop multi-media training and publicity materials to encourage better home-school co-operation;
  • To advise the Education Bureau and other government departments and non-government organizations on ways to promote positive parental involvement in the education process;
  • To conduct surveys to investigate current perceptions of home-school relationships, the attitudes of parents, and the improvements required;
  • To advise teacher education institutions, through the Advisory Committee on Teacher Education & Qualifications, on ways to incorporate the concepts and skills of working with parents in courses of initial teacher training, refresher courses and in-service training for school heads and teachers; and
  • To facilitate and support schools in promoting parent education.

Others

The Committee on Home-School Co-operation had conducted 'home-school co-operation' visits to neighboring areas. The knowledge and experience gained by members during the visits helped the Committee in finding a better direction for long-term development of home-school co-operation in Hong Kong . At the beginning of the 21st century, the Committee keeps holding topical campaign annually. Apart from the Ceremony for 10th Anniversary of the Committee in 2003, functions with topics in "New Parents in 21st century", "New Century Learning-Family" and "Let's Create our Learning-Family" were also organized in the past few years.
